
The Fluency Habit: English for Real Life
This podcast helps you bring English into your life in a natural, authentic, and entertaining way. It covers English pronunciation, cultural considerations, and listening comprehension through stories and chat, using comprehensible input. The show leaves grammar drills behind and focuses on genuine, authentic communication. It is brought to you by Phonetic Fluency.
